Senior PMO Analyst

Posted 1 day ago by Experis

My client are looking for a Senior PMO Analyst to support a major transformation programme and contribute to wider Enterprise PMO Activities. The role is key to strengthening governance, planning, reporting, AID management, dependency tracking, and delivery assurance across a complex change environment. This role is Outside IR35, and for an initial duration of 6 months.

This is a great opportunity for a proactive PMO professional who can bring structure, insight, and control to large-scale delivery programmes while supporting the ongoing development of PMO capability across the organisation.

The role is predominantly remote, with occasional attendance required for key meetings and workshops.

Key Responsibilities

  • Maintain programme governance, reporting cycles, and delivery cycles
  • Product Steering Committee packs, executive updates, and management reporting
  • Manage programme plans, milestones, dependencies, and delivery roadmaps
  • Track risks, issues and assumptions, decisions, and actions (RAID), ensuring timely escalation and resolution
  • Coordinate reporting and governance activities across multiple workstreams
  • Support planning, change control, dependency management, and delivery assurance.

Enterprise PMO Support

  • Support portfolio reporting, governance and management information activities
  • Consolidate project and programme status reporting
  • Prepare reporting for senior Leadership and governance forums
  • Support Portfolio-level RAID, dependency and milestone management

PMO Standards and Assurance

  • Contribute to PMO frameworks, standards and governance processes
  • Promote consistent reporting and project controls across the organisation
  • Support assurance reviews, healthchecks, and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Identify opportunities to improve visibility, control, and delivery effectiveness.

Essential Skills & Experience

  • Proven PMO Experience within a large-scale transformation or change programme
  • Strong planning, RAID management, dependency tracking, milestone reporting, and change control experience
  • Ability to produce high-quality executive and governance reporting
  • Experience in supporting multi-workstream delivery involving internal teams and third party suppliers. Excellent stakeholder management, communication and organisation skills.
  • Strong attention to detail and confidence to challenge constructively
  • Experience supporting portfolio reporting, delivery assurance, and PMO continuous improvement activities
  • Experience working on Billing/Accounting/Payment Systems

Desirable

  • Experience supporting operational or technology platforms, including testing, data reconciliation exception management, and operational readiness activities.
  • Experience contributing to PMO maturity or governance improvement initiatives
  • Experience in a Regulated Environment, ideally in Financial Institutions
